  23. G

    hook me up with a EI recipe?

    40-60 Gallon Aquariums +/- 1/2 tsp KN03 3x a week +/- 1/8 tsp KH2P04 3x a week +/- 1/8 tsp K2S04 3x a week +/- 1/8 (10ml) Trace Elements 3x a week 50% weekly water change CO2, most shoot for 30ppm. consistency is as important as value, if not more.
